Registering Your Business in the Emirate: Needed Documents & Expenses

Embarking on the venture of registering your company in Dubai involves familiarizing yourself with specific procedures and projected outlays. Generally, it's necessary to have to choose a entity type, such as a special economic zone establishment or a local entity. If you opt for a Free Zone, the process is usually easier, but necessitates adherence to zone-specific regulations and usually involves registration costs ranging from AED 15,000 to AED 50,000+. Meanwhile, businesses operating onshore necessitate permission from the DED and might experience higher costs, possibly ranging from approximately AED 25,000 - 100,000+, depending on the type of business and the amount of partners.
